Common Ghost Controls Gate Repair Problems We Solve in Orlando

  • Control board failure from lightning strikes. Central Florida’s lightning-strike density is among the highest in the continental US, and Ghost Controls boards—like all electronic gate controls—take the hit when a surge travels through underground wiring. We stock OEM replacement boards for the TSS series and can verify whether your existing board is salvageable before recommending replacement.
  • Motor burnout on TSS series openers. Ghost Controls rates its TSS1N and TSS2N motors for typical residential duty cycles. In Orlando’s vacation-rental communities like Windsor Hills and Reunion Resort, those motors see 400–600 cycles daily from guest turnover. We’ve replaced TSS1N motors that failed in 18 months after running the equivalent of 15 years of normal use.
  • Loop detector damage from heavy shuttle traffic. The pavement-embedded vehicle loops at US-192 resort communities get pulverized by rental shuttle vans, luggage carts, and moving trucks. A standard loop detector lasts years in conventional residential use; in Storey Lake or Windsor Hills, we’ve seen them fail three times in one calendar year. We install shielded aftermarket loop detectors that withstand this abuse better than OEM equivalents.
  • Photocell sensor degradation from UV exposure. Orlando’s year-round intense solar radiation degrades the infrared lenses and wiring insulation on Ghost Controls photocells faster than the manufacturer projects. The result is intermittent gate reversal—your gate starts closing, then suddenly opens again for no apparent reason. We use UV-resistant aftermarket photocells that outlast the factory spec in Florida conditions.
  • Battery backup system failures. Ghost Controls’ battery backup kits are popular in Orlando for hurricane-season reliability, but Florida heat accelerates battery sulfation. We test backup systems under load, not just at rest voltage, and replace batteries with high-temperature-rated units that won’t leave you manually cranking a gate when the grid goes down.

Ghost Controls Service in Orlando: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ment

Orlando’s extraordinary concentration of short-term vacation rental communities creates a repair demand pattern found nowhere else in Florida. ChampionsGate, Reunion Resort, Windsor Hills, Storey Lake—developments clustered along US-192 and the I-4 corridor—run their community gates through hundreds of cycles daily from Airbnb and VRBO guest turnover. Most residential gate operators, Ghost Controls TSS series included, are engineered for 50–100 cycles per day. That math doesn’t work here, and the failure modes prove it.

We responded to a TSS1N failure at Windsor Hills where the motor had seized from 600+ daily cycles from vacation rentals. Our team replaced it with a heavy-duty TSS2N motor, upgraded the loop detector to a shielded model, and had the gate running smoothly in under 4 hours. This isn’t a story we tell for color—it’s the actual work we do weekly in Orlando’s resort corridors. The loop detector replacements alone, driven by heavy rental shuttle traffic cracking pavement and severing wire loops, represent a failure mode virtually nonexistent in conventional residential neighborhoods. Most technicians relocating from other markets don’t anticipate it until they’re already on the call, staring at a loop that tested fine last month and reads open circuit today.

Ghost Controls Service Pricing in Orlando

Ghost Controls repair costs in Orlando typically fall between these ranges:

  • Diagnostic service call: $95–$145 (waived with approved repair)
  • Control board replacement (OEM): $280–$420
  • TSS series motor replacement: $340–$580
  • Photocell sensor pair (aftermarket UV-rated): $140–$220
  • Loop detector replacement (shielded aftermarket): $180–$340
  • Battery backup system installation: $260–$440

What drives the spread? Motor replacement on a TSS3D with heavy-duty arms takes longer than a TSS1N swap. Loop detector work in cracked resort pavement requires more excavation and repair than a clean residential install.
